Description

The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ration (PHMSA), through the U.S. Department of Transportation (DOT), hereby requests applications from eligible States that may result in the award of multiple grants under the State Damage Prevention Program. These grants are intended for States to establish or improve the overall quality and effectiveness of their programs that are designed to prevent damage to underground pipeline facilities.Section 2 of the PIPES Act added a new State Damage Prevention Program Grant program to the Federal Pipeline Safety Law as 49 USC §60134. The purpose of these grants is to establish comprehensive State programs designed to prevent damage to underground pipelines in States that do not have such programs and to improve damage prevention programs in States that do. The Act sets forth nine elements of an effective State damage prevention program. A critical element is the establishment of effective enforcement measures including civil penalty authority for violations.*** Notice *** The grants PHMSA awards under this announcement will not affect the grants PHMSA awards under the One-Call program. PHMSA awards under the One-Call program were posted in a separate announcement. Although this notice is limited to applications for the Damage Prevention Program, the relevant authorities in a State may apply for both a One-Call grant and a grant under this program as long as the deliverables under each program are different. PHMSA will carefully coordinate the application review process for the State Damage Prevention Program Grants to ensure that applicants are not awarded funds for the same deliverable under both grant programs. Eligible applicants are encouraged to apply for both grants.
